Output 338843675d10cbe5425e183bd4da1fe0c16e30483422dce0f5f4097d9e330894:16

value
231289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4e9325cff40e361103afe79b7528ebf40bd7e0 OP_EQUAL
address
3EPbygS8MCTLSBT5aob5ZNnDy2JviXbW7L
transaction
338843675d10cbe5425e183bd4da1fe0c16e30483422dce0f5f4097d9e330894
confirmations
155110
spent
true